The Ati Rudra Maha Yajnam is a rare and powerful Vedic ritual dedicated to Lord Shiva, known for its immense spiritual energy and global healing vibrations. Rooted in the Smarta Shastra and blessed by Bhagavan Sri Sathya Sai Baba, this grand yajna brings together Vedic scholars, devotees, and spiritual seekers to invoke divine grace through the chanting of Sri Rudram, the most potent Vedic hymn for universal peace, purification, and enlightenment.

Event Schedule
Each day of the yajna is dedicated to a specific focus, with intentions and prayers offered for the welfare and upliftment of humanity:

Day 1: Children’s welfare
Day 2: Youth and adults
Day 3: Middle-aged & senior citizens
Day 4: Righteous living
Day 5: Character development
Day 6: Love and self-control
Day 7: Ecological balance
Day 8: Disaster prevention
Day 9: Holistic development
Day 10: Spiritual awakening
Day 11: Surrender and liberation
